Overview of Contemporary Hip Hop musician Joey Bada$$
Joey Bada$$ is a hip hop artist from Brooklyn who has established a reputation in the field of contemporary hip hop music. His direct delivery, reflective lyrics, and socially sensitive messages define his distinctive approach. Since starting to work in the industry in 2012, Joey has made a name for himself as one of the top voices of his generation.
The emphasis on language and storytelling during the prime of Hip Hop had a big influence on Joey's music. He has, nevertheless, also been able to add contemporary sensibilities to his music, creating a sound that is both nostalgic and new. His songs cover a wide range of subjects, from political issues to personal struggles, and are consistently delivered with an honesty that is uncommon in today's music business.
Joey made a huge contribution to the Hip Hop culture and encouraged a new generation of musicians to take a more mindful approach to their work. Many of the top Hip Hop musicians working now can be seen to have been influenced by him, and his legacy will undoubtedly last for many years to come.

What are the latest songs and music albums for Contemporary Hip Hop musician Joey Bada$$?
American rapper Joey Bada$$, who is from Brooklyn, has been putting out music that combines classic and modern hip hop styles. His most recent album, "2000 (2022)," highlights his lyrical skill and distinctive flow. The songs on the album cover a range of subjects, including the difficulties faced by Black men in America and the value of self-love and preservation. The production of the CD is particularly remarkable; the jazzy to soulful beats perfectly complement Joey's lyricism.
The most recent single from Joey Bada$$, "Fallin' (2023)," demonstrates his artistic development. The song has a chill sound and reflective lyrics that discuss topics like achievement, celebrity, and mental health. It's a welcome change from the usual braggadocious rap music that rules the charts. Joey's flexibility as an artist is further demonstrated by other recent songs like "Let It Breathe" (2022), "Zipcodes" (2022), and "Survivors Guilt" (2022), with each tune providing something unique.
Overall, Joey Bada$$'s most recent works show evidence of his growth as an artist. While staying faithful to his beginnings, he continues to push the limits of hip hop. His music is a mirror of the times we live in, with beats that are both retro and modern and lyrics that address significant social issues. Joey Bada$$ consistently establishes himself as one of the most dynamic and forward-thinking rappers in the industry.

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Contemporary Hip Hop musician Joey Bada$$?
Throughout his career, Joey Bada$$ has collaborated with a variety of talented musicians, but some of his most significant projects include "infinity (888)" with XXXTENTACION, "1Train" with A$AP Rocky, Kendrick Lamar, YelaWolf, Danny Brown, Action Bronson, and Big K.R.I.T., and "Survival Tactics" with Capital Steez.
Due to the vast array of gifted rappers included on the song, "1Train" stands out as a particularly successful collaboration. An enormous, eight-minute song that highlights the greatest of modern hip-hop is created as a result of each performer bringing their distinctive flavor to the mix. Joey Bada$$ distinguishes out thanks to his effortless flow and insightful lyrics.
The song "infinity (888)" by XXXTENTACION is another noteworthy collaboration. The song has a melancholy piano melody and powerful lyrics that discuss topics like mortality and mental health. Joey Bada$$'s verse is strong and moving, demonstrating why he is regarded as one of the best lyricists in the industry.
Though Joey Bada$$ has collaborated with a variety of outstanding musicians throughout the years, his projects with A$AP Rocky, XXXTENTACION, and Capital Steez stand out as some of the most significant and influential. These songs highlight his artistic diversity and his capacity for working with others to produce really unique works of art.

How old was Joey Bada $$ when he dropped 1999?
Joey Bada$$ was 17 years old when he dropped 1999.
